ActivationCount¶
Calculate a simple Activation Count Maps
Adapted from: https://github.com/poldracklab/CNP_task_analysis/ blob/61c27f5992db9d8800884f8ffceb73e6957db8af/CNP_2nd_level_ACM.py
Inputs:
[Mandatory]
in_files: (a list of items which are an existing file name)
input file, generally a list of z-stat maps
threshold: (a float)
binarization threshold. E.g. a threshold of 1.65 corresponds to a
two-sided Z-test of p<.10
[Optional]
ignore_exception: (a boolean, nipype default value: False)
Print an error message instead of throwing an exception in case the
interface fails to run
Outputs:
acm_neg: (an existing file name)
negative activation count map
acm_pos: (an existing file name)
positive activation count map
out_file: (an existing file name)
output activation count map
